HANDOVER NOTE — DIRECTOR TRANSITION

To the heads of department: I am passing the second-source supplier search for the Calverro sensor line to Director Ambleside. Two candidates remain — Fenwright Components and Tollis Precision — both mid-audit. Qualification samples, pricing comparisons, and risk assessments are filed in the shared dossier. Please route all supplier correspondence through Ambleside's office from Monday. The confidential note below explains the strategic rationale.

board note of kageg-bahof: The renewal with Holwynax Holdings closes at $2 million a year, 5 percent below the last contract. Project Ulaath slips by two quarters because of the supplier delay.

TURN-208: Gatevale turnstile counters at the Merrow Field pilot double-count when a rotation reverses mid-cycle. Attendance totals drift roughly 2% high per event. The debounce window fix is implemented, reviewed by Ilsa, and soak-tested across two simulated match days without drift. Ready for your cut; the candidate build is identified below.

trace token, tagag-tafog: htk6_5ed18c

Ticket SQG-412: Scanner misses hyphen/underscore swaps

The Quillguard typo-squat scanner flags transposed characters but not hyphen-to-underscore substitutions, so a lookalike of our internal package slipped past last week's audit. Fix adds a normalization pass before edit-distance scoring. Unit tests cover both separators. For the eng sync: review the candidate build before we promote it. Trace token for that build is below.

build token for kagaf-hahof: htk14_9d3d4d26d7d8de

## Releases

The Threnody websocket library ships two builds: one with per-message deflate enabled and one without. Compression saves bandwidth on chatty plugins but costs roughly 15% more memory per connection, so pick the variant that matches your workload. Plugin authors publishing to the Lattermill registry must sign their release artifacts so the loader can verify provenance. Verify your bundles against the registry's published deploy key, shown below.

rollout seal: bky4_DFM9